JAKARTA - President Prabowo Subianto is scheduled to lead a plenary cabinet meeting at the Presidential Palace in Jakarta, Friday, March 13. The session will discuss the government's readiness to face the Idulfitri 1447 Hijriah/Lebaran 2026 holiday.
The cabinet meeting will be attended by all members of the Red and White Cabinet, ranging from ministers, deputy ministers, heads of agencies, presidential special advisers, to presidential special assistants.
"So, today there will be a cabinet meeting regarding the readiness of Lebaran at 16.00 WIB," said Cabinet Secretary (Seskab) Teddy Indra Wijaya in a written statement, Friday, March 13.
Before the cabinet meeting, President Prabowo and cabinet members were scheduled to pay zakat fitrah and zakat mal through the National Zakat Agency (Baznas).
The zakat payment activity will be held at the State Palace and is part of President Prabowo's agenda ahead of the cabinet meeting.
"It started with the event of paying zakat mal and zakat fitrah from cabinet members to the National Zakat Agency at the State Palace, it was around 15.00 WIB," concluded Teddy.
The plenary cabinet meeting chaired by President Prabowo is scheduled to discuss various government preparations ahead of Lebaran 2026, including the readiness of the transportation sector, infrastructure, security, and the stability of the supply and prices of basic necessities.
The meeting became a forum for coordination between ministries and agencies so that various government programs could run optimally during the homecoming and Eid al-Fitr holidays.
The government is also expected to ensure that public services continue to run well during the 2026 Lebaran long holiday.
